#ifndef _LINE_HXX
#define _LINE_HXX
#include "tools/toolsdllapi.h"
#include <tools/gen.hxx>
class Link;
// --------
// - Line -
// --------
class TOOLS_DLLPUBLIC Line
{
private:
Point maStart;
Point maEnd;
public:
Line() {};
Line( const Point& rStartPt, const Point& rEndPt ) : maStart( rStartPt ), maEnd( rEndPt ) {}
void SetStart( const Point& rStartPt ) { maStart = rStartPt; }
const Point& GetStart() const { return maStart; }
void SetEnd( const Point& rEndPt ) { maEnd = rEndPt; }
const Point& GetEnd() const { return maEnd; }
long Left() const { return ( maStart.X() < maEnd.X() ) ? maStart.X() : maEnd.X(); }
long Top() const { return ( maStart.Y() < maEnd.Y() ) ? maStart.Y() : maEnd.Y(); }
long Right() const { return ( maStart.X() > maEnd.X() ) ? maStart.X() : maEnd.X(); }
long Bottom() const { return ( maStart.Y() > maEnd.Y() ) ? maStart.Y() : maEnd.Y(); }
double GetLength() const;
BOOL Intersection( const Line& rLine, double& rIntersectionX, double& rIntersectionY ) const;
BOOL Intersection( const Line& rLine, Point& rIntersection ) const;
BOOL Intersection( const Rectangle& rRect, Line& rIntersection ) const;
double GetDistance( const double& rPtX, const double& rPtY ) const;
double GetDistance( const Point& rPoint ) const { return( GetDistance( rPoint.X(), rPoint.Y() ) ); }
Point NearestPoint( const Point& rPoint ) const;
void Enum( const Link& rEnumLink );
};
#endif // _SV_LINE_HXX
